Though I am already quite certain that it is indeed him who sits before me, I ask the question to seek confirmation.

"Theo?"

When he first hears my voice his head seems to pick up slightly from its low hung position. He turns ever so slowly to look towards where he had heard my voice from, his eyes widening faintly as the recognition goes through his mind.

And when those soft lips of his, that he appears to have been gnawing at, open, his voice is void of any emotion at all to my presence.

"Ella." he says with a curt nod in greeting accompanied by his blank expression.

I don't know what to say to him. He clearly couldn't care less if I was here or not and just needs to be left alone right now. I'm tempted to just retreat away slowly, lest I say something to push him further into this sour mood he seems to be in at this moment.

"I didn't know you were going to be here," he says, saving me from having to come up with something to say but also worrying me with the tone he uses when he says you, "I take it you're here with Damon." he guesses.

I nod in response, not wanting to take the risk of using any words at this moment.

He just stares back at me with that empty expression, a sense of fatigue appearing from behind his eyes; not to mention the dark bags which are clearly forming beneath them. I can't bear to maintain the eye contact, the extended contact with his domineering gaze intimidating me slightly, so I quickly flash my gaze away.

However, this does nothing to deter his gaze from me, catching them as they rake my figure up and down to observe my appearance, once I gather the courage to look him in the eyes again. His instinctual response after this is to take a long sip of the glass of scotch which nows awaits him on the bar, confusing me more as to what was going on in that head of his.

"Son, what are you doing over here?" a voice suddenly interrupts from behind Theo, "I need you to come and speak with Mr. Vidlovski over there. He wants to talk about the hotel venture."

The man has now completely stopped to stand right beside Theo. The way he had been approaching this spot I had just assumed he was coming for a drink.

Theo barely responds to the words, his look only slightly moving from where they had returned to look at me. He looks up at the polished man who stands before him with that same look of dissatisfaction from earlier as the man looks between the two of us, seemingly noticing that he might have interrupted something.

Before he can reply to the man, Theo takes one last chug of drink, finishing it off completely before he turns back to him.

"Ella, this is my father Charles Harrington. Father, this is a friend of mine, Ella Adams." he says, introducing us and utilising the word friend which at least reassures me of my position to him.

"It's a pleasure to meet you Miss Adams," he responds in the charming British tone his son's is usually like as he outstretches his hand for me to shake, "I assume he has brought you along as his plus one then?"

I take his hand in mine in greeting as I deny his assumption by saying "no, I'm actually here with Damon Morales."

As he acknowledges this information, I take this moment to observe the appearance of Theo's father and compare it to his own. Now that I'm aware of their link I can pick up on the features which they share such as the stature and their steely blue eyes.
